Futures Command Forges Academia Partnerships, Breaks Ground on New Research Hub
October 16, 2019
WASHINGTON, Oct. 16 -- The U.S. Army News Service issued the following news:

As the Army's youngest command, Army Futures Command has already developed strategic partnerships with hundreds of colleges and universities over the past year.

"We're leveraging the strength of academics and intellectual freedom to position Army modernization in a way to win the fight before an actual fight," said Gen. Mike Murray, its commander.
